Understanding Osteoarthritis of the Knee: Symptoms, Diagnosis, and Treatment
Osteoarthritis with the knee is a common wear-and-tear condition that causes pain, stiffness, and reduced range for motion. Symptoms typically develop gradually over time and often worsen following activity or prolonged sitting.
Diagnosis involves a physical examination, medical history review, and imaging tests such as X-rays. Treatment options for osteoarthritis of the knee aim to manage pain, reduce inflammation, and improve function. These may consist of lifestyle modifications, medications, rehabilitation, and in some cases, surgical interventions.
Lifestyle changes, including maintaining a healthy weight, engaging in low-impact activities, and using assistive devices can help reduce stress on the knee joint. Medications can to manage pain and inflammation, such as nonsteroidal anti-inflammatory drugs (NSAIDs) or corticosteroids.
Physical therapy plays a crucial role in osteoarthritis management by strengthening muscles around the knee, improving flexibility, and enhancing joint stability.
Surgical interventions are often recommended for individuals with severe symptoms that are not effectively managed by non-surgical treatment options. These procedures often involve knee replacement surgery or arthroscopic debridement.
Navigating Life with Osteoarthritis: Strategies for Pain Management
Osteoarthritis can make everyday activities challenging and painful. But don't despair! There are effective strategies you can implement to manage your pain and improve your quality of life. Firstly pinpointing your painful areas and the activities that exacerbate them. This awareness can help you modify your lifestyle to minimize stress on your joints.
A healthy diet rich in fruits, vegetables, and whole grains can strengthen your body and improve overall well-being. Consistent exercise, particularly low-impact activities like swimming or walking, can boost joint flexibility and muscle strength. Remember to heed to your body and avoid doing too much.
- Explore stabilizing devices like braces or canes to alleviate joint stress.
- Warm compresses and cold therapy can relieve pain and inflammation.
Consult your doctor about pharmaceuticals that can help manage your osteoarthritis symptoms. They may also recommend occupational therapy to enhance joint function and range of motion.

The Impact of Osteoarthritis on Daily Function impact
Osteoarthritis can significantly limit daily activities, causing pain in the joints. Simple tasks such as ascending stairs, contorting to obtain objects, and even strolling can become challenging. Individuals with osteoarthritis may experience a reduction in their flexibility, which can impact their ability to take part in favorite activities and maintain their independence.
As the condition progresses, the restrictions imposed by osteoarthritis may increase. This can cause dissatisfaction and a lower overall quality of life.
